Pristine Beaches and Natural Beauty

The Riviera is famous for its diverse coastline, featuring over 30 beaches ranging from lively, well-developed shores to secluded coves. Popular beaches like Mogren, Jaz, and Bečići are ideal for swimming, sunbathing, and water sports. Crystal-clear waters and dramatic rocky backdrops make the area a paradise for photographers and nature lovers. The mild Mediterranean climate ensures long summers and pleasant spring and autumn seasons, making it a year-round destination.

 

Rich History and Cultural Heritage

Budva is one of the oldest towns on the Adriatic, with a history dating back over 2,500 years. The Old Town (Stari Grad) is a maze of narrow stone streets, medieval walls, and historic landmarks such as the Citadel and ancient churches. Walking through Budva’s old quarter feels like stepping back in time, where Venetian, Roman, and Slavic influences come together. Cultural festivals, music events, and traditional celebrations add to the region’s vibrant identity.

Nightlife and Entertainment

The Budva Riviera is also known for its energetic nightlife. Beach clubs, open-air bars, and nightclubs come alive after sunset, especially during the summer months. Budva has earned a reputation as the party capital of Montenegro, attracting international DJs and music lovers from across Europe. At the same time, quieter towns along the Riviera provide a more relaxed evening atmosphere for those who prefer calm seaside dinners.

 

Activities and Day Trips

Beyond beaches and nightlife, the region offers plenty of activities. Visitors can enjoy boat tours to nearby islands, hiking in coastal hills, or day trips to charming towns like Sveti Stefan and Petrovac. Adventure seekers can explore water sports, while history enthusiasts can visit nearby monasteries and archaeological sites.
